body{margin:0px;background-image:url(../images/bg_body.jpg);background-repeat:repeat-x;background-color:#B9C6C8; font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;}

#top{width:950px;margin:auto;height:122px;}
#logo{width:276px;float:left;padding-left:18px;}
#toplinks{width:138px;float:left;padding-left:319px;}
#top_left{width:13px;height:30px;float:right;background-image:url(../images/img_toplink_left.jpg);background-repeat:no-repeat;}
#top_center{width:112px;height:30px;float:right;background-image:url(../images/bg_toplinks.jpg);background-repeat:repeat-x;padding-top:5px;}
#top_right{width:13px;height:30px;float:right;background-image:url(../images/img_toplink_right.jpg);background-repeat:no-repeat; margin-right:20px; display:inline;}
#top_home{ width:11px; height:11px; float:left; margin-left:13px; margin-top:2px; display:inline;}
#top_msg{ width:12px; height:9px; float:left;margin-left:28px; display:inline; margin-top:4px;}
#top_sitemap{ width:13px; height:10px; float:left;margin-left:28px; display:inline; margin-top:3px;}
#links{width:950px;margin:auto;height:43px;}
#link_con{margin-left:185px;}

#content
	{
		margin:auto;
		background-image:url(../images/bg_btmcontent.jpg);
		background-repeat:no-repeat;
		background-position:bottom right;
		background-color:#FFFFFF;
		border:1px solid #809598;
		width:948px;
		min-height:543px;height: auto !important; height:543px;
		margin-top:10px;
	}

/*Left*/
.left{ height:544px; width:250px; border-right:1px solid #B1BFC2; vertical-align:top; background-color:#DDE6E7;}
.sec_con{ width:250px;}
.sec_con .title{ height:36px; width:250px; background-image:url(../images/bg_title_left.jpg); background-repeat:repeat-x;}
.sec_con .title .title_text{ font-size:12px; font-weight:bold; vertical-align:middle; text-align:left; color:#3D575D; margin-left:10px;}
.sec_con .links_con{ border-bottom:1px solid #C2CDD0;}
.sec_con .links_con .sub_links{ margin-left:15px; margin-top:5px; margin-bottom:5px; font-size:11px; color:#3D575D;}
.sec_con .links_con .sub_links td{padding:4px;}
.sec_con .links_con .sub_links a:link{ text-decoration:none; color:#3D575D;}
.sec_con .links_con .sub_links a:visited{ text-decoration:none; color:#3D575D;}
.sec_con .links_con .sub_links a:hover{ text-decoration:underline; color:#3D575D;}

/*Welcome*/
#uc{ margin-top:60px; width:300px;}
#uc .text{font-size:12px; color:#3D575D; text-align:justify;}
#uc .name{ text-align:right;}

/*Footer*/
#footer
	{
		margin:auto;
		background-image:url(../images/bg_shdwfooter.jpg);
		background-repeat:no-repeat;
		width:950px;
		min-height:21px;height: auto !important;height:21px;
		font-size:9px;
		color:#5C767C;
		text-align:center;
		padding-top:5px;
		line-height:17px;
	}
#footer a:link, a:visited{ text-decoration:underline; color:#6D868C;}
#footer a:hover{ text-decoration:none;color:#404040;}
